How to Estimate Power Usage
To get an idea of how long a device can run on a Portable Power Station, you can use a simple calculation. Please note, this is only an estimate, as real-world usage can vary based on efficiency and other factors.
Examples:
|
Power Station Capacity |
Device Power Usage |
Estimated Run Time |
|---|---|---|
|
1200Wh |
400W |
1200 ÷ 400 = 3 hours |
|
1000Wh |
250W |
1000 ÷ 250 = 4 hours |
|
500Wh |
100W |
500 ÷ 100 = 5 hours |
Keep in mind:
- This is a rough estimate - actual performance may be shorter or longer depending on real usage conditions.
- Ensure your device power usage is below the max rated watts the power station can ouput.
- Always allow some buffer in your calculations to account for energy loss or variations in power draw.
- Some Power Stations can use Expansion Batteries to extend their capacity.
Wattage Reference Guide*
| Device | Average Power Usage |
|---|---|
| Lamp | 10 |
| LED/LCD TV | 150 |
| Laptop | 100 |
| Desktop Computer | 200 - 500 |
| Modem/Router | 20 |
| Play Station | 165 |
*This chart is for reference only. Check your device for ACTUAL wattage requirements.
